How America spent 20 years in Afghanistan, only to have the Taliban resume control again as its troops withdrew, will be a topic for historians to ponder for decades. Here's how four presidents have approached what became America's longest war.

Implicit in that statement is the belief the war shouldn't have been passed to him, nearly 20 years after it began.Each president since 2001 has confronted an evolving mission in Afghanistan, one that resulted in tens of thousands American and Afghan casualties, frustratingly futile attempts to improve the country's political leadership and a Taliban that stubbornly refused defeat.

Shortly afterward, Obama announced he would begin bringing US troops home with a goal of handing off security responsibilities to the Afghans by 2014.Over the next years, troop levels declined steadily as the US engaged in fraught diplomacy with Afghanistan's leaders.
